Complexity of Injection Molding Machine

The primary difference between die casting and using an injection molding machine is the complexity of the plastic mold itself and the fact that an injection molding machine uses higher-pressure injection of the melted material, as opposed to low pressure, or gravity feed.

The complicated shapes desired for an injection molding machine process requires that higher pressure be used in order for the plastic or metal to be dispersed completely and quickly within the mold configuration.

One of the reasons that makes this process so well used is that the speed of production is greatly enhanced because it takes much less time to forcibly inject the material into a plastic mold than to rely on gravity.

Injection Molding Machine and Small Articles

Of course, the heavy, non-hollow constructs are still best made with the die cast method.  The plastic injection molding machine is better suited to create finished products with thinner material.  In fact, most metal production applications are limited to a smaller sized article for a number of reasons.

Because of the weight involved castings must be smaller than about 24 inches.  There is a very high initial cost involved which necessitates being able to use the mold over and over again.  The metals used must have a high fluidity.

Plastics injection probably has the largest numbers of application and use today with the unending list of plastic items that are being used and thrown away instead of re-used. Plastic is so much less expensive and adaptable to application that we make everything from toys to automobiles out of it.

The broader range of tooling machines used to produce an ever expanding number of items is growing at a furious rate.  Thermoplastics, (plastics created to melt and form), can be injected, pressed, and carved.

Plastics Injection, leads the way in production technique closely followed by another form of the injection molding machine.  The use of the extrusion machine involves pressing these thermoplastics through ports to shape them into hoses, tubes, and filaments of all dimensions.

Regardless of the material, the injection molding machine has transformed the industrial world and the world we live in.After the initial cost, tooling, and setup is dealt with the advantages make this method, (whether it’s using plastic of viscous metal),  a  highly economical process with a large range of applications.

The metal parts created last longer than those of plastic and have a higher incidence of dimensional consistency.  With both materials there is almost no need for tooling the part further after it is released from the mold. Full automation and repeated use of molds make the injection molding machine the best choice for parts that have to be created in large numbers over a long period of time.
